Understanding Cash on Delivery (COD)
Cash on Delivery (COD) is a payment method where the recipient pays for goods or services in cash at the time of delivery. This means you do not pay upfront when placing an order online or arranging a service; instead, you hand over the payment to the delivery person or service provider once the item has arrived or the service has been rendered. COD eliminates the risk associated with online payments, such as credit card fraud or non-delivery of goods, because payment is only made upon receipt. This method is particularly popular in regions where credit card penetration might be lower, or where consumers prefer the tangible security of paying only after inspecting the product or confirming the service. In Playa del Carmen, like many other parts of Mexico and the world, COD remains a relevant and trusted payment option for various transactions.
Benefits of Using Cash on Delivery
The primary benefit of paying with cash on delivery is the enhanced security and trust it offers. Consumers can inspect the product or confirm the service completion before handing over any money, significantly reducing the risk of scams or receiving substandard items. This is particularly valuable for online purchases where you cannot physically examine the product beforehand. Another key advantage is accessibility; COD is ideal for individuals who may not have access to credit cards or bank accounts, or who are hesitant to share their financial details online. It provides a straightforward payment solution for a broader segment of the population. Furthermore, COD can simplify the purchasing process, especially for smaller businesses or local service providers, as it doesn’t require complex payment gateway integrations. For consumers, it offers a sense of control and certainty, knowing that payment is directly tied to receiving the intended value.
Potential Downsides and How to Mitigate Them
Despite its benefits, COD does have potential downsides. For sellers, it poses risks such as increased chances of order cancellations upon delivery if the customer is unavailable or decides not to purchase, leading to logistical costs and wasted effort. For buyers, it requires having the exact cash amount ready at the time of delivery, which might be inconvenient if you don’t carry much cash. To mitigate these issues: For Buyers: Always ensure you have the correct cash amount available. Confirm the delivery window and be present to receive the item. Inspect the goods immediately upon delivery. If purchasing online, ensure the seller is reputable and clearly states their COD policy. For Sellers: Implement a clear return and cancellation policy. Consider charging a small, non-refundable deposit for COD orders to screen serious buyers. Maintain excellent communication with the customer regarding delivery details. Educate your customers on the process and requirements. By understanding and addressing these points, both buyers and sellers can have a more positive experience with COD transactions.

Online Shopping and COD Availability
Many online retailers that ship within Mexico, including those serving Playa del Carmen, offer cash on delivery as a payment option. This is especially true for smaller e-commerce businesses, local artisans, or companies that understand the preference for tangible payment security among a significant portion of their customer base. When browsing online stores, look for payment options that explicitly mention “Efectivo contra entrega,” “Pago en contra entrega,” or “Contra reembolso.” Always verify the credibility of the online seller before placing an order, even if COD is available. Check for customer reviews, clear contact information, and established business practices. Some larger online marketplaces might also facilitate COD through their network of local delivery partners.
Local Services and Restaurant Deliveries
In Playa del Carmen, paying with cash on delivery is a standard practice for many local services and restaurant deliveries. If you order food from a local eatery that offers delivery, you can typically expect to pay the driver in cash upon receiving your meal. Similarly, various local businesses, from appliance repair services to furniture stores, may offer COD for their services or products. When booking a service or ordering delivery, confirm the payment method with the provider upfront. Ask if they accept cash only or if other payment options are available for the remaining balance if the total amount exceeds the cash you have on hand. This clear communication ensures there are no surprises when the service is completed or the delivery arrives.

Online Payment Methods
For online shopping, credit and debit cards remain the most popular payment methods. Major providers like Visa, MasterCard, and American Express are widely accepted by most e-commerce platforms operating in Mexico. Additionally, many Mexican online stores and payment gateways support options like bank transfers (SPEI) or digital wallets such as Mercado Pago, PayPal, or OXXO Pay (which allows cash payments at OXXO convenience stores, offering a hybrid approach). These digital methods are often processed instantly, providing immediate confirmation and security. For businesses, integrating these options can streamline transactions and broaden their customer reach.
Other Payment Options Locally
In Playa del Carmen, for in-person purchases at physical stores, restaurants, and service providers, cash is universally accepted. Alongside cash, credit and debit cards are commonly used at established businesses. Many smaller vendors or tourist-oriented establishments may also accept payments via popular digital wallets. For services, especially those involving significant costs like tours or accommodation, payment terms can vary, often requiring a deposit via card or transfer, with the balance potentially payable in cash or by card upon completion or arrival. Always inquire about accepted payment methods when booking services or making purchases locally.
